How to Fix a Upvc Door Locking Mechanism

A Upvc door locking mechanism could not work properly due to a variety of reasons. It could be due to a loose or damaged lock, a broken hinge or misalignment. Intruders can also cause damage.

Adjusting the butt hinges

You may need to adjust the hinges if the uPVC door isn't locking correctly. To do this, open the door and remove all caps protecting it. Then, you'll have to turn the pins in the slots to adjust them in counterclockwise and clockwise motions.

Begin by leveling the door before you adjust the uPVC hinges. You can make use of a level or a marker pen to mark the start point. When the door is level you can move the adjusters at the top and bottom away.

Depending on your uPVC door model, you might need to remove the caps that protect it to expose the slot. To do this, you'll need a Phillips or cross-head screwdriver. After removing the protective caps and loosening the screws and remove the slot caps.

white-room-with-door-2021-12-09-14-11-05-utc.jpgThen, you'll require an Allen key. Most doors made of uPVC have one adjustment slot for each hinge. Some uPVC door models require an Allen key. Other models won't come with adjustment slots.

Typically, butt hinges are commonly found on older uPVC door models. However, you can discover modern designs that allow for side-to-side movement. Some older butt hinges require the use of a cross-head or Phillips screwdriver.

You can also adjust the flag hinges on uPVC doors. They can be adjusted in two ways either in height or compression. Each hinge will have an adjustable pin that runs through the top of the hinge that is attached to the door. This adjustment lets you open or close your door vertically, horizontally, or both.

Some uPVC doors come with lateral adjustment. This adjustment allows you to move the hinge closer to the jamb. This is typically hidden under a plastic cover.

Misalignment

If your UPVC door is sticking, it might be due to a misalignment of the lock mechanism. It doesn't matter if the problem is simple or complex; however, it should be handled immediately by a professional.

Misalignment can be caused by many reasons, including broken hinges, damaged or cracked glass panel, and insufficient packing. Temperature fluctuations can cause doors to expand and contract, which can cause misalignment.

Getting your uPVC door aligned is a quick and easy process. It usually takes less than five minutes. A spirit level can be used to determine the distance between your door frame and sash.

Cool water can be used to dowse your doors. This can fix the alignment issue. It takes only less than a minute and could save you money on repairs.

One of the biggest problems with UPVC doors is the prevalence of misalignment. This is particularly the case with hinges of older design that aren't intended to be adjusted. A malfunctioning locking mechanism could be a sign of trouble even if the issue is only a slight misalignment.

Although it's easy to forget the issue, exposure to the elements can cause alignment problems. For instance, driveway gravel can interfere with the frame of your door.

A poorly packed door panel could result in an unevenly aligned UPVC door. This can result in issues with locking and unlocking, or make the handle unfit properly.

In extreme weather conditions, your UPVC door might expand or shrink. While this is not a bad thing however, it could cause problems with your uPVC door locking mechanism.

To correct the misalignment, you can alter the door's hinges or repack the lock. The locksmith will help you determine the best way to get your door working again.
